Ride Along Program

The Ride-A-Long program provides citizens an opportunity to expierence the law enforcement function first hand.
Reasonable attempts will be made to accomodate interested persons; however any applicant may be disqualified without cause. Some of these factors may be considered in disqualifying an applicant and are not limited to:
  • Prior criminal history
  • Pending criminal action
  • Pending lawsuit against the department
  • Denial by any supervisor
All requests will be approved by the Police Chief after a completed Ride-A-Long form has been submitted. Once the ride-along has either been approved or denied, a representative from the Police Department will contact you by telephone and advise him/her.

No more than one ride-along will be allowed in the officer's vehicle at a given time.

Any person who is having a ride-along may be refused if you are not properly dressed. The approved person is required to be suitably dressed in collared shirt ot jacket, slacks and shoes. Tank tops, shorts, ripped or torn blue jeans, T-shirts or sandals, are not permitted. Hat and ball caps will not be worn in the police vehicle.
